The king of creative Midnight Madness entrances once again found another memorable way to open the Michigan State basketball season. Tom Izzo and his staff starred in Mission Izzpossible, which depicted the Michigan State coach rescuing the national championship trophy from thieves. Then Izzo arrived clad in a Tom Cruise-esque dark suit as the Mission Impossible theme played in the background. "We've gone to seven Final Fours in the last 17 years, which is more than Duke, Kansas, Kentucky or anyone else," Izzo told the crowd at the Breslin Center." But the mission is we've got to win another national championship." In past years, Izzo has pulled off all sorts of creative Midnight Madness entrances, from dressing as Iron Man, to driving a race car, to rappelling from the ceiling, to being shot out of a cannon. This year's entrance won't eclipse last year's when Izzo dressed as a member of the band KISS, but it's further proof the king of Midnight Madness isn't abdicating his crown anytime soon.
